What is a keyless-entry system?


The keyless entry system you have in your vehicle is a remote control system that enables you to lock and unlock your car without physically inserting the keys. The keyless entry system is usually found on a keyfob or integrated into the ignition key handle. Some models offer the option of remotely locking the tailgate and trunk.

The system transmits a radio signal to a computer in your car. The car analyzes the signal to determine whether it is the correct key. If it's the correct key it will unlock the doors instantly and the engine can start. The key fob also contains an embedded security chip to prevent the vehicle from starting if a faulty key is used.

While keyless entry systems are convenient, they do come with some disadvantages. They may be activated accidentally by children playing with them, or turned on when the owner isn't present in the vehicle. This can cause the power windows and other features to function without the owner's knowledge or permission and may trigger the alarm in the car.

Another concern is that there are a variety of ways thieves can breach the security of keyless entry systems and hack into your vehicle's computer to make it believe that your key fob is near enough to enable the car to start. It is therefore important to ensure that you have a backup working fob or key.

How do I change the battery in my keyless entry system?

Replace the batteries in your keyfob each few years or whenever you notice it's less responsive. This can be done within less than 10 seconds. You don't have to reprogram the key fob every time you change the battery.

It is essential to have the right battery in your arsenal. If you flip the key fob it, you should see the type of battery written on it. If the battery type is not visible you can remove the key fob using a flat-head screwdriver to check inside. Key fobs usually accept CR-1620 battery, which is easily available at a variety of stores, including Home Depot Walmart & AutoZone.

After you've removed the mechanical key from the key fob, you can easily open it by making use of a flathead screw driver or your fingernail. Replace the battery you used with the new one you purchased. The positive (+) side of the new battery must be facing upwards. Reassemble the two sides and then snap it shut.
